Police Chief Ben Tsosi, of Tuba City, the only son of a WWII Code Talker,
is a Vietnam War Vet and former Navy SEAL with a secret, black ops life.
The Chief appreciates the talents of his forensic wizard, the Indian Health
Clinic's psychologist, Dr. T.R. von Prospel. The Doc teams-up with the
Chief creating the magic blend against crime in a 9/11 terror world.
However, she is a Buddhist, an Ecumenical Minister, and volunteers as a
death row spiritual advisor and execution witness ---for Navajo inmates.
Passion flows from these characters.

Adjusting to traumatic events in the
acute stage as well as in the long term
are her areas of expertise. Rev Mary
Helen's ministry is soul-healing in mental health
mental health. She teaches and uses
mindfulness ---MINDFUEL--- as a
technique for handling emergencies

and emphasizes rationality and
compassion as compatible mental sets in
helping others and helping yourself.
 
Re-sensitizing the professional who
is disenfranchised and
desensitized,
has become  her core practice
 for
thirty years in debriefing the
traumatized.
